What are the key skills and qualifications needed to thrive as an Advanced Process Control Engineer, and why are they important?

To thrive as an Advanced Process Control Engineer, you need a solid background in chemical or process engineering, strong analytical skills, and typically a bachelor's or master's degree in a related field. Proficiency with distributed control systems (DCS), process simulation software like AspenTech, and experience with control algorithms or programming languages such as MATLAB or Python are commonly required. Strong problem-solving abilities, effective communication, and teamwork are crucial soft skills for collaborating with cross-functional teams and implementing solutions. These skills ensure safe, efficient, and optimized plant operations, directly impacting production quality and profitability.

The Advanced Process Control Engineer specializes in developing sophisticated control strategies to optimize industrial processes, often working on complex systems. In contrast, the Process Control Engineer focuses on maintaining and troubleshooting existing control systems. Both roles share similar environments and required skills, but the advanced engineer typically handles more complex control algorithms and process optimization projects.

What are Advanced Process Control Engineers?

Advanced Process Control (APC) Engineers are specialized professionals who design, implement, and maintain advanced control systems in industrial processes, such as those used in chemical, oil & gas, or manufacturing plants. Their goal is to optimize production efficiency, improve product quality, and minimize costs by utilizing advanced algorithms, software, and control strategies. They work with various technologies, such as model predictive control, real-time optimization, and data analytics, to enhance process operations. APC Engineers often collaborate with process engineers, operators, and IT specialists to ensure the successful integration of control solutions. Their expertise contributes significantly to the safe, efficient, and sustainable operation of industrial facilities.
